### Step 4: Backfill the loyalty-points ledger

Before enabling dual-writes on Cloverdime, backfill historical point grants into the new ledger schema. Run the backfill script in batches of 10,000 rows, verifying checksums after each batch against the legacy totals table. Pause if drift exceeds 0.01%. The script reads its target ledger database from the connection string below.

replica DSN, kajep-yahag: mssql://praok_svc:iF@db-8d68.plorvaio.local:5432/eliion

## Approvals: Tide-Table Widget

Heads up for release: the ShoreCast tide-table widget needs explicit sign-off before each deploy, since a bad datum once showed low tide six hours off at Gullford Pier. Validation script is `check_tides.sh`; run it, attach output to the release ticket. Final approval rests with the engineer named below.

named custodian: Oliath Ralax

## Onboarding: Fareweight Rules Engine

Fareweight computes shipping fees from stacked rule sets. Rules are versioned; never edit a live version. Deploys go through the staging evaluator first. Read the rule DSL guide before touching anything.

Rule definitions live in the pricing database — connect to it with the connection string below.

primary connection of yagep-bajop = postgresql://druiel_svc:gW@db-3860.sivrelworks.example:5432/brieth